Output 6451c7036663e454659a4e70f4780582a7352bd71eb5c9d33a6b204de841a751:0

value
321601026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75430e5a1db2ce295588cb8e99ca2878efe7763c OP_EQUAL
address
3CP3K8C9W2NfkRLbQ5FvD6yTLdkgYK4Rz8
transaction
6451c7036663e454659a4e70f4780582a7352bd71eb5c9d33a6b204de841a751
spent
true